An admin panel allows administrators of an application, website, or IT system to manage its configurations, settings, content, and features and carry out oversight functions critical to the business. They can see the state of the platform and take any action they want.

admin panels allow their users to handle business-related functions such as monitoring customer accounts, solving user problems, and processing transactions, in addition to technical and administrative tasks.
